Larsons biggest boat ever, the 370 Cabrio builds on the companys long history of providing a lot of boat for the money. Theres nothing high-tech or cutting-edge about the 370hull construction is solid fiberglass; fit and finish is impressive considering the price, and the styling is on a par with most the competition. The Cabrios base price, however, was refreshingly attractive and she came with enough standard equipment to make her a true turnkey boat. Starting with a well-designed cockpit and including a spacious interior, the Cabrio offers most of the amenities of her higher-priced counterparts with little sacrifice in quality. Her midcabin floorplan is typical of boats her size with berths for six, a spacious galley, and a double-entry head compartment. A solid door separates the master stateroom from the salon, and attractive cherrywood laminates are applied liberally throughout the interior. A wet bar is standard in the cockpit along with wraparound aft seating, carry-on cooler, and a removable cocktail table. Also standard is a genset, radar arch, microwave, VacuFlush toilet, windlass, and air conditioning. Twin 375hp Volvo I/Os cruise at 25 knots (about 30 knots wide open).
